Cold Avocado Soup

- 2 C. chopped ripe Avocado (3 or 4 small avocados) shopping list
- 3 C. milk, preferably Whole shopping list
- kosher salt to taste shopping list
- cayenne pepper to taste shopping list
- 2 Tbls. freshly squeezed lime juice, or to taste shopping list
- A handful or more of small cooked shrimp shopping list
- Chopped fresh cilantro or parsley leaves shopping list
How to make it
- Put chopped avocado in a blender or food processor.
- Add half the milk, a large pinch of salt and a small pinch of cayenne; process to a puree.
- Add remaining milk and puree.
- Chill for up to six hours if you have the time. (Press a piece of plastic wrap to surface of soup so it does not discolor.)
- Be sure and chill soup bowls in freezer before serving.
- Add lime juice, taste, and adjust seasoning, if necessary.
- Garnish with shrimp and parsley or cilantro and serve.
